8-Bromo-2,3-dihydro-4(1H)-quinolinone

CAS 38470-29-0C9H8BrNOChemical Synthesis

8-Bromo-2,3-dihydro-4(1H)-quinolinone (CAS 38470-29-0) is a halogenated heterocyclic compound with the molecular formula C9H8BrNO and a molecular weight of 226.07 g/mol. It serves as a valuable building block in organic synthesis, particularly for the construction of more complex quinoline-based structures. Its utility lies in its reactive bromine atom, enabling diverse functionalisation pathways for research and development in various chemical sectors.

01 /Applications

Organic Synthesis Intermediate

This compound is employed as a key intermediate in the synthesis of various organic molecules. The bromine substituent allows for facile cross-coupling reactions and other derivatizations, facilitating the creation of novel chemical entities.

Heterocyclic Chemistry Research

As a functionalised quinolinone derivative, it is utilised in academic and industrial research for exploring new synthetic methodologies and developing novel heterocyclic compounds with potential applications in medicinal chemistry and materials science.

Building Block for Complex Molecules

Its structure makes it a useful precursor for assembling more intricate molecular architectures. The quinolinone core, coupled with the bromine handle, offers strategic advantages in multi-step syntheses.

02 /Properties
Molecular weight226.07
Empirical formulaC9H8BrNO
Assay97%
Melting point53-58 °C
03 /Safety & handling
GHS hazard pictogram: Toxic (GHS06)
Toxic
Danger

Hazard statements

  • H301Toxic if swallowed
  • H315Causes skin irritation
  • H319Causes serious eye irritation
  • H335May cause respiratory irritation

Precautionary statements

  • P261Avoid breathing dust, fume, gas or vapours
  • P301IF SWALLOWED
  • P305IF IN EYES
Flash point>110 °C / >230 °F
Transport (UN / ADR)UN 2811 6.1 / PGIII
Water hazard class (WGK, DE)3
Hazard codes (EU)Xn
Risk statements (R)22-36/37/38
Safety statements (S)26

Hazard information is provided for guidance. Always consult the product Safety Data Sheet (SDS), available on request, before handling.
